Lacefield advises early-season morel hunters to focus on southward and westward slopes. They will have the warmest, early season soil. “You sometimes can find them in grassy areas,” he notes. “But generally the higher humidity of the forest is going to encourage the growth better.”. Don’t procrastinate!!!! Call Chris directly at 478- -217- -5200. Half-Free Morel: Consistent days of 61-68 may trigger fruiting. Gray Morel: Consistent days of 59-67 may trigger fruiting. Yellow Morel: Consistent days of 71-77 may trigger fruiting. Verpas, Gyomitras, Helvellas (False Morels): Follow a different life cycle and may be present the duration of morel season.

Morels are hollow, head to toe from the top of the cap to the bottom of the stalk. Some mushrooms are solid all the way through, and some are chambered and seemingly “stuffed” with cottony material. Morels will have none of that. Kbshroom, Morelevant, morelsxs and 1 other person. Like.For a dehydrator, set the temp to 110 degrees and go for 8-10 hours. For an oven, go with the lowest possible temperature and keep the oven cracked for 8-10 hours. You can then freeze them in jars for up to a year. When you’re ready to cook, rehydrate the mushrooms in a bowl of water for 20 minutes.Psilocybe sp. The two most important features to examine when trying to identify a morel mushroom are the cap shape and whether the interior is hollow. Morels have a very distinct cap. Fairly uniform, they appear ridged and pitted inwards. Mo still has many good morels, I have yet to leave many behind. connect network gtl visit me This is usually mid-April up to mid-May, once the temperatures warm up enough for Morels to come up. These mushrooms need moisture to grow, so you’ll find them in areas with damp soil. They often grow near dead trees and, in Pennsylvania, are known to grow around Elm, Apple, Tulip Poplar, Ash, or Sycamore trees. harbor freight in west monroe Pennsylvania. 2023 MOREL SEASON FINDS.
